Originally released in a long sold-out edition of 50 cassette tapes, Love, Emily (Acte 3) was the third and final album of Michel Henritzi’s industrial label AKT Production. Recorded in a Paris studio in 1987, this 25-minute collage of spoken word and noise saturations intersects two radical voices from literature and experimental music of the time: American author Kathy Acker reading excerpts from her book My Death My Life by Pier Paolo Pasolini, and Nox, mainstay of the French noise and indust…

Javier Hernando's musical journey began in 1979 with his first band, Xeerox. In 1981, he embarked on his first fully electronic project, Melodinamika Sensor, which continued until 1985. During that year, three tracks by M.S. were featured on a compilation LP titled Grupos de Barcelona, released by Discos Esplendor Geométrico. This compilation showcased four bands from the thriving Barcelona underground scene. From 1985 to the early nineties, Hernando co-directed the cassette label Ortega y Casse…

*2023 stock* Industrial legends Hunting Lodge was founded in May of 1982 by Lon C. Diehl, Carla J. Nordstrom & Richard Skott Rusch. To commemorate the 40th anniversary of the band’s inception and of their initial releases, this set contains the entirety of the recorded output from the original lineup. A mandatory archival release that New Forces is very proud to make available as a 3-CD set. Harrington Ballroom is a restoration of the first Hunting Lodge release, a live recording from their firs…
